A Fashion Movement, Not Just Merch
Beyond Music Promotion
Many musicians release merch as a byproduct of an album — Tyler does more. His fashion is a parallel form of storytelling, with themes, colors, and characters evolving alongside his discography.For example, the pastel tones of Flower Boy were mirrored in that era’s Golf Wang collections. Similarly, the bold, luxury-inspired designs of Call Me If You Get Lost echoed the confidence and extravagance of the album itself.This integration makes every item more meaningful — not just wearable, but collectible and symbolic.
